How much does it cost to rent a home in Greater St Augustine?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Greater St Augustine 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,943 | $700 | $7,500 |
Greater St Augustine 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,460 | $750 | $10,000+ |
Greater St Augustine 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,505 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
Greater St Augustine 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,316 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
Greater St Augustine 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,749 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|
Greater St Augustine 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$23,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Greater St Augustine
What type of rentals are currently available in Greater St Augustine?
There are currently 1515 Apartments for Rent in Greater St Augustine, FL with pricing that ranges from $517 to $8,500. There are also 2378 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Greater St Augustine ranging from $650 to $25,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Greater St Augustine?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Greater St Augustine ranges from $650 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$6,091.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Greater St Augustine?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Greater St Augustine range from $717 to $7,671,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$750 to $14,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,250 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$837.
